Predictive Analysis for copyright Markets: Navigating with Data-Driven Trading
The volatile landscape of copyright markets presents both challenges and opportunities for traders. Harnessing predictive analytics can empower investors to make strategic decisions by analyzing historical data, market trends, and various other indicators. A powerful understanding of these analytical techniques can boost trading outcomes and minimize risk.
- Quantitative approaches involve utilizing statistical models and algorithms to identify patterns and predict future price movements.
- Fundamental analysis considers economic indicators and news events that may influence copyright prices.
- Technical analysis focuses on studying historical price charts and trading volumes to detect trends and signals.
By incorporating these predictive tools into their trading strategies, investors can gain a competitive edge in the dynamic copyright market.
